Episode Synopsis
Special guest Dr. Tyler Burton joins me to ask the question, Why does trauma matter?
Trauma is an internal change and neurological adaptation to an event or series of events like a physical accident, physical assault, natural disaster or un foreseen circumstance in one’s life.
Trauma is normal, Trauma is an effective tool for safety and survival and it is not the event we carry with us, but rather the imprint on the mind, body and brain. The issue is when someone has difficulty moving forward and adapting in healthy ways, finding acceptance, gratitude and reconnecting in what happened and where they want to be.
